Other neighbourhoods around Crossroads Arts District

Hospital Hill
Though Hospital Hill may not have many top sights, you can venture to the surrounding area to see attractions like CrossroadsKC at Grinders and SEA LIFE Kansas City Aquarium.

Power and Light District
The ample dining options and great live music are just a few popular features of the neighbourhood. Make a stop by Arvest Bank Theatre at the Midland or T-Mobile Center while you're visiting, and jump aboard the metro at Power and Light Tram Stop to get around town.

Westside North
If you're looking for some top things to see and do in Westside North and surrounding area, you can visit Kauffman Center for the Performing Arts and Science City at Union Station.

Crown Center District
Spend some time visiting places like National World War One Museum and Memorial while getting to know Crown Center District, and be sure to check out the abundant dining options. You can hop aboard the metro at WWI Museum & Memorial Tram Stop or Union Station Tram Stop to see more of the area.

Downtown Kansas City
Known for its ample dining options and great live music, there's plenty to explore in Downtown Kansas City. You can visit top attractions like Arvest Bank Theatre at the Midland and Kansas City City Hall, and jump on the metro at Metro Center Station or Library Tram Stop to see more of the city.

Beacon Hills
While there might not be top attractions in Beacon Hills, you can explore the larger area and discover places like Hallmark Visitors Center and Crown Center.
